some fresh air, and Briggs Creek in Oregon is the outdoors at its most excellent. While visiting this area in Oregon it's a good idea to go for a weekend of camping too. Nearby there is a glorious 31-mile-from-beginning-to-end
| | type IV(V) whitewater bit, the Miami Bar to Oak Flat sector of Illinois River. The beginners should possibly stay away from this bit of Illinois River. Unsurprisingly, whitewater rafting and kayaking is cool but risky; check restrictions ahead of going. A good wilderness trail featuring a variation between top and bottom of 3,879 feet, and 33.2 miles from start to finish, is to be found in the neighborhood. This lovely wilderness trail is the Illinois River Trail. There's no more excellent way to use four days than to backcountry hike the demanding Illinois River Trail. 3,391 feet is the difference in altitude of nearby Upper Chetco Trail.
